Traditional Swabian dumplings filled with minced meat, spinach, breadcrumbs, and onions.
Soft egg noodles often served as a side dish with meat and gravy or enjoyed with cheese as 'Käsespätzle'.
Rostbraten (roasted beef) topped with roasted onions, typically served with a side of Spätzle.

Prices are moderate compared to other German cities. Accommodation is reasonable, but dining can vary.
Round up the bill or leave 5-10% in restaurants. Round up in taxis. Tipping is not expected in cafes.
